The mission of the Disability Access Office (DAO) is to work towards a universally designed environment that makes it easy for all people, regardless of disability, to participate fully in community life. This mission echoes the spirit of the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) of 1990 and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973. The San Antonio Building Access Modification Plan, coordinated by the DAO, serves as a master plan to modify all City facilities to accommodate all users. A City Council appointed Disability Access Advisory Committee (DAAC) serves as a valuable resource.

The DAO coordinates with other City Departments to review and amend city codes, policies, and procedures to assure they are universally usable to all. The DAO oversees an interdepartmental Sidewalk Compliance Team, participates in other jurisdiction's access and planning initiatives and trains and provides technical assistance to City Departments and the private sector in meeting the requirements of the ADA. Documents illustrating these efforts are available on request from the Public Works Department.
